Doja Cat and The Weeknd: The Ultimate Musical Match-Up

Doja Cat and The Weeknd represent two of the most influential voices in modern pop and R&B, often compared for their genre-blending style and chart dominance. Their overlapping eras have shaped streaming culture, production trends, and vocal experimentation across the music industry.

Rather than a simple rivalry, their catalogs highlight distinct approaches to mood, storytelling, and sonic identity. Understanding their signature traits helps listeners decode current radio patterns and streaming algorithms.

The Sonic World of Doja Cat

Doja Cat frequently blends hip-hop cadence with pop melodies and retro electronic textures, creating tracks that feel both casual and meticulously crafted. Her vocal agility allows quick shifts between playful rap verses and soulful hooks, which keeps listeners engaged across streaming platforms.

Producers around her signature sound prioritize bouncy drums, creamy basslines, and unexpected sample choices. This approach has made her songs staples on TikTok, radio, and fitness playlists alike, demonstrating broad adaptability across contexts and audience segments.

The Aesthetic and Emotional Landscape of The Weeknd

The Weeknd cultivates a nocturnal, cinematic atmosphere where deep bass, reverb-soaked vocals, and minimalist arrangements evoke isolation and excess. His work often reads like a late-night drive through neon-lit streets, balancing sensuality with introspection.

Songwriting choices highlight emotional ambiguity, allowing tracks to function as both club anthems and reflective ballads. This duality helps his music remain relevant across varied playlists, from workout sessions to midnight mood compilations on streaming services.

Both artists push boundaries between pop, R&B, hip-hop, and electronic music, yet they do so with different emphasis. Doja Cat leans into wit and genre mashups, while The Weeknd favors mood continuity and immersive sound design.

Producers working in this space often borrow trap hi-hat patterns, synth leads, and vocal processing techniques originally popularized by these artists. As a result, emerging musicians study their catalogs to understand how to balance commercial appeal with unique sonic signatures in crowded markets.

Which artist has more chart-topping hits on mainstream radio?

The Weeknd has accumulated more long-running number ones on mainstream charts, though Doja Cat has achieved multiple rapid ascents with viral-driven singles that quickly top airplay lists.

How do their approaches to storytelling in lyrics differ?

Doja Cat tends to use conversational, sometimes playful storytelling with quick tonal shifts, while The Weeknd favors sustained, cinematic narratives that explore dark romance and personal conflict.

Which artist influences modern production styles in streaming playlists more?

Both influence playlists heavily, with The Weeknd shaping dark, cohesive album-oriented streams and Doja Cat driving trend-focused, sample-heavy micro-trends that appear across recommendation feeds.

Do their collaborations often blend their signature sounds in obvious ways?

Joint projects frequently merge The Weeknd’s atmospheric R&B with Doja Cat’s eclectic pop sensibilities, creating hybrid tracks that highlight vocal contrast and experimental yet accessible production.
